The Blue Ridge Parkway’s 75 th Anniversary 1935-2010
Brief Description of Event: The Blue Ridge Region will host a year-long celebration and commemoration in 2010 marking the Parkway’s 75 th Anniversary with Educational Symposia, over 200 activities and festivals in surrounding communities, and a multi-day, multi-venue festival staged in and around Cumberland Knob, NC- where Parkway construction began- on September 10-12, 2010. With this in mind BRP 75, Inc. purposes to have an interpretive event featuring antique trailers and camping equipment in the Picnic Area at Cumberland Knob. We would develop signage and interpretive exhibits featuring some historic photos of early camping units on the Parkway and visitors could walk and maybe drive through the sites and visit the units and talk with the owners about their units.
Date: September 9-12, 2010 (may depart on 13 th , also)
Location: Picnic area at Cumberland Knob, North Carolina
Number of units allowed at event: 11 units will be selected from the 1930’s to 1965
